Got a reply from Stephanie (HQ Product Specialist)

The Test Drive vehicles we have available are pretty limited at this time. If you could let me know what kind of car you prefer, color, battery size, interior options, I can find something close to what you are looking for and we can discuss pricing and time frame then. Full disclaimer, this is a new process (to sell test drive vehicles) so it will take me a bit of time to get the perfect car for you. Also, in terms of time frame, when were you looking to receive the car by?

Your vehicle purchased will have a NEW vehicle warranty in tact – as these cars have never been registered yet, you can also apply for the $7500 Federal Tax Credit and any state incentives. It will come with a full review and full refurbishment.

You’ll get a price break dependent on mileage. Therefore, cars will be at full price minus a 50 cents per mile discount. 2000 miles at $1000 off, for instance.
We have a nice collection of Performance vehicles, of the Blue/Pearl White variety with a mix of Tan or Black interiors. These all have Tech, Sound Studio packages.

Elon announced yesterday that loaner cars would be available to buy at a discount of 1%/month old and $1/mile. I assume that test drive cars would now be available for the same deal.

But not the current crop of test drive cars, which were the first ones off the line and really aren't up the normal production standards and also went through the GetAmped circuit.
